A tetra with scales sparkling like diamonds. Mature males have elegantly elongated fins.
The diamond tetra (Moenkhausia pittieri) is a characin native to Lake Valencia and its tributary rivers in Venezuela. Growing to 5–6 cm, its appeal lies in the spectacular iridescent quality of its scales — each reflecting silver, violet, and gold depending on the angle of light, creating an overall diamond-studded sparkle across the body. Mature males develop elegantly elongated dorsal and anal fins, adding a graceful silhouette to their glittering appearance. A vivid red upper iris adds further accent. Young specimens are relatively plain, making the dramatic transformation into adult coloration a rewarding experience for patient aquarists. Slightly acidic to neutral water (pH 6.0–7.5) at 24–28°C suits them well. Groups of ten or more create a mesmerizing school of shimmering fish against green planted backgrounds. Peaceful and active, they accept a varied diet of granules, flake food, and frozen foods. Breeding on fine-leaved plants in slightly acidic soft water is achievable.
